Bangor City FC poised for stadium move
Bangor City Football Club (BCFC) is poised to move to a new stadium under plans for the development of a new Asda supermarket on the site of its current home.
Deiniol Developments has now exchanged contracts with Asda for the scheme, having already secured planning permission for a 125,000sq ft (11,613sq m) store. BCFC chair Dilwyn Jones said: "With the club performing well on the field the new facilities at Nantporth will be a further boost."
